puttin a CAT stack on my 1st gen

well I picked up an 8" CAT stack for cheap and I'm gonna put it on ol blacky. I can't wait to put it on, I just need some 4" pipe to make a downpipe and then I'm goin 5" from the end of the t case up into the bed and than I'm gonna make a 5" to 8" flange to connect to my CAT stack. I can't wait to put it on and see what it sounds like! here is an idea of what it will look like, I just set it on a 5 gallon bucket.



oh and I found a piece of 8" stovepipe in our basement so i think I will put that on the bottom of the CAT stack so It will be 8" from the bottom of the bed up.

what do you guys think???
